BURDEN OF COSTS
FARMERS EXPRESS CONCERN INVITATION TO MINISTER Concern at the continued rising costs for farmers was expressed at a meeting of the South Auckland Dairy Association in Hamilton this week, when it was decided to write to the Minister of Agriculture, the Hon. W. Lee Martin, inviting him to come to Hamilton to discuss with the farmers of the district the position that has arisen, especially with regard to increased transport costs. All members agreed that a conference with the Minister was necessary as the increasing costs were rapidly becoming too big a hurdle for the farmers. No date for the meeting was fixed, it being decided to invite the Minister to name a date which would suit him, although the urgency of the question will also be pointed out to him.
